FCB plc give Silver Strikers K19 million for FCB 30th Anniversary win
[Nyasa Times - Malawi] - 3/09/2025
First Capital Bank (FCB) plc has handed over a K19 million cheque to Silver Strikers following their 2-0 victory against FCB Nyasa Big Bullets in the Bank’s 30th anniversary celebration on June 29. FCB’s chairman, Hitesh Anadkat, who graced the celebrations promised to spoil the champions with (…)
